Is Calor Gas Butane Or Propane. The key difference between propane and butane is their boiling point. 19kg / 47kg propane bottle. Butane is more commonly used as a refrigerant, propellant, or to fuel portable cooking stoves. It's a fuel that has to be liquefied and stored in a butane (blue) gas bottle. Butane is sold in small bottles. Butane (c 4 h 10), like propane, is a type of lpg. You can opt for either butane gas or propane gas. Domestic use home portable heating 6kg cube, or a. Propane can handle much lower temperatures, which is why it’s used in homes. See below for commonly used cylinders for both domestic and commercial appliances. The main differences are that butane ceases to gas off at around 0 degrees c, whereas propane will do so well below freezing.
